What is the significance of the muffle furnace heat treatment in Si@Sn@C preparation? Unlock Structural Stability


The muffle furnace heat treatment serves as a critical pre-stabilization phase for Si@Sn@C precursors following the spray-drying process. This step is not about the final carbonization, but rather about preparing the internal architecture of the material by maintaining a constant temperature of 300 °C to ensure structural integrity.

Core Takeaway This intermediate heating step acts as a "stress-relief" and structural locking phase. By processing the precursor at 300 °C, the muffle furnace stabilizes the oxide forms and eliminates internal tensions, providing a robust physical template necessary for the successful application of the subsequent carbon coating.

The Role of Pre-Heat Treatment

The primary function of the muffle furnace in this context is to bridge the gap between the physical formation of the particles (via spray-drying) and the final chemical modification (carbon coating). It addresses the deep need for a stable substrate.

Stabilizing the Material Structure

Spray-drying creates spherical particles, but these structures can be fragile or chemically active.

The muffle furnace treatment locks these structures in place. It ensures that the morphology achieved during drying does not collapse or deform during later processing stages.

Releasing Internal Stresses

Rapid drying processes often introduce significant mechanical tension within the material particles.

If left unchecked, these internal stresses can lead to cracking or pulverization during battery cycling. The 300 °C heat treatment relaxes the material, dissipating these stresses before the composite is finished.

Adjusting Crystalline States

The chemical nature of the oxides within the precursor requires fine-tuning.

This thermal step adjusts the crystalline state of the oxides. This ensures the chemical composition is in the ideal phase to interact with the carbon coating that will be applied later.

Critical Considerations and Trade-offs

While heat treatment is standard in materials synthesis, the specific use of a muffle furnace at this stage involves distinct parameters that must be respected.

The Importance of Temperature Precision

The target temperature of 300 °C is specific.

It is high enough to induce the necessary stress relief and crystalline adjustments, but low enough to avoid premature reaction or unwanted phase changes that might occur at higher temperatures (such as those used in carbonization).

Pre-Treatment vs. Final Treatment

It is crucial to distinguish this step from the final carbonization process.

This is a pre-treatment step. Attempting to combine this stabilization with high-temperature carbonization in a single step can lead to a defective framework, as the material may undergo thermal shock or structural shifting before the protective carbon layer is fully formed.
